Stob Coire Claurigh – Roof of the Grey Corries from the fine subsidiary top of Stob Coire na Ceannain to the north east. Early April spring snow wreathes the east face of Stob Coire Claurigh. Aonach Beag, Ben Nevis and Aonach Mor are poking their heads up on the right of the shot whilst Buachaille Etive Mor and the Black Mount peaks are distant on the left. The ridge out to Stob Coire na Ceannain from Stob Coire Claurigh is highly recommended. It’s an easy but airy ridge and less frequented that the main Grey Corries summits with a great view to boot.
